Что Такое C-Деревья?

Что такое деревья в C? Дерево — это нелинейная структура данных в C, которая содержит узлы, которые не связаны линейно, а иерархически . Узлы присутствуют на разных уровнях и соединены ребрами.

Запрос на удаление Посмотреть полный ответ на Scaler.com

Что означает дерево в кодировании?

Дерево — это совокупность объектов, называемых узлами. Узлы соединены ребрами. Каждый узел содержит значение или данные и может иметь или не иметь дочерний узел. Первый узел дерева называется корнем.

Запрос на удаление Посмотреть полный ответ на freecodecamp.org

Как создать дерево в C?

Программа C для построения дерева и выполнения операций с деревом
  1. /*
  2. * Программа на языке C для построения дерева и выполнения вставки, удаления и отображения.
  3. #include <stdio.h>
  4. #include <stdlib.h>
  5. структура btnode.
  6. {
  7. целое значение;
  8. структура btnode *l;

Запрос на удаление Посмотреть полный ответ на sanfoundry.com

Какие деревья используются для кодирования?

Деревья обычно используются для представления иерархических данных или управления ими в таких приложениях, как: Файловые системы для: Структура каталогов, используемая для организации подкаталогов и файлов (символические ссылки создают не древовидные графы, как и несколько жестких ссылок на один и тот же файл или каталог).

Запрос на удаление Посмотреть полный ответ на ru.wikipedia.org

Как найти дерево в C?

Поисковая операция
  1. Сравните элемент, который нужно найти, с корневым узлом дерева.
  2. Если значение искомого элемента равно значению корневого узла, верните корневой узел.
  3. Если значение не совпадает, проверьте, меньше ли значение корневого элемента или нет, а затем пройдите через левое поддерево.

Пример 3: Захвати 1000 бонусных баллов за покупку X и Y вместе!

Пример 3: Захвати 1000 бонусных баллов за покупку X и Y вместе!

Запрос на удаление Посмотреть полный ответ на Scaler.com

Как реализовать дерево в C

Какие деревья есть в C?

Виды деревьев
  • Бинарное дерево.
  • Бинарное дерево поиска.
  • Дерево АВЛ.
  • B-дерево.

Запрос на удаление Посмотреть полный ответ на programiz.com

Как напечатать дерево в C?

Доступ к части данных текущего узла. Перейдите левое поддерево, рекурсивно вызывая функцию предварительного заказа. Перейдите правое поддерево, рекурсивно вызывая функцию предварительного заказа.

Есть 4 способа распечатать двоичное дерево поиска:
  1. Порядок прохождения уровней.
  2. Предварительный заказ обхода.
  3. Обход по порядку.
  4. Обход после заказа.

Запрос на удаление Посмотреть полный ответ на stackoverflow.com

Каковы преимущества деревьев в программировании?

Дерево — это абстрактный тип данных (ADT), который соответствует иерархическому шаблону сбора данных. Используя дерево, программисты и специалисты в области обработки данных могут структурировать свои данные таким образом, чтобы каждый узел мог ссылаться на любое количество дочерних узлов, но дочерний элемент мог ссылаться только на один узел.

Запрос на удаление Посмотреть полный ответ на in.indeed.com

Каковы применения деревьев в C?

Ниже приведены применения деревьев:
  • Хранение данных в естественной иерархии. Деревья используются для хранения данных в иерархической структуре.
  • Организация данных: используется для организации данных для эффективной вставки, удаления и поиска.
  • Три: это особый вид дерева, который используется для хранения словаря.

Запрос на удаление Посмотреть полный ответ на javatpoint.com

Как работают языковые деревья?

В Языковом дереве (см. ниже) ствол дерева представляет нашу базовую языковую систему, разбитую на четыре части: говорение, аудирование, чтение и письмо. Хотя язык — это одна живая система, он подобен многоствольному дереву — отдельному, но все же являющемуся частью целого.

Запрос на удаление Посмотреть полный ответ на rootedinlanguage.com

Как нарисовать дерево кода?

Мы собираемся нарисовать его в четыре шага.
  1. Шаг 1: Давайте нарисуем дерево, как это делает стандартный элемент управления деревом Windows.
  2. Шаг 2. Переместите все родительские узлы в строку их первого дочернего элемента.
  3. Шаг 3: Шаг номер 2 очистил несколько строк.
  4. Шаг 4. На последнем этапе нам нужно рекурсивно центрировать родителей над всеми их детьми.

Запрос на удаление Посмотреть полный ответ на codeproject.com

Что такое дерево в структуре данных?

Дерево — это иерархическая структура данных, определяемая как набор узлов. Узлы представляют ценность, а узлы соединены ребрами. Дерево имеет следующие свойства: Дерево имеет один узел, называемый корнем. Отсюда происходит дерево, и, следовательно, у него нет родителя.

Запрос на удаление Посмотреть полный ответ на mygreatlearning.com

Как вы создаете данные дерева?

Самая первая вставка создает дерево. Впоследствии, всякий раз, когда необходимо вставить элемент, сначала найдите его правильное местоположение. Начните поиск с корневого узла, затем, если данные меньше значения ключа, найдите пустое место в левом поддереве и вставьте данные.

Запрос на удаление Полный ответ можно посмотреть на сайте Tutorialspoint.com.

Как лучше всего использовать дерево?

10 основных способов, которыми деревья помогают нашей планете
  • Деревья дают пищу.
  • Деревья защищают землю.
  • Деревья помогают нам дышать.
  • Деревья дают убежище и тень.
  • Деревья — это естественная игровая площадка.
  • Деревья способствуют сохранению биоразнообразия.
  • Деревья дают устойчивую древесину.
  • Деревья экономят воду.

Запрос на удаление Посмотреть полный ответ на Trees.org

Как лучше всего использовать древовидный алгоритм?

Древовидные алгоритмы считаются одними из лучших и наиболее часто используемых методов обучения с учителем. Алгоритмы на основе деревьев обеспечивают высокую точность, стабильность и простоту интерпретации прогнозных моделей. В отличие от линейных моделей, они достаточно хорошо отображают нелинейные зависимости.

Запрос на удаление Посмотреть полный ответ на сайтеanalyticsvidhya.com

Каковы плюсы и минусы информатики о деревьях?

Преимущество: деревья обеспечивают эффективную вставку и поиск, а деревья представляют собой очень гибкие данные, позволяющие перемещать поддеревья с минимальными усилиями. Недостаток: Недостаток заключается в том, что для изменения списка и его извлечения требуется время O(log n).

Запрос на удаление Посмотреть полный ответ на сайтеwardsdatascience.com

Почему деревья важны в CS?

В вычислительной технике двоичные деревья в основном используются для поиска и сортировки, поскольку они предоставляют средства для иерархического хранения данных. Некоторые распространенные операции, которые можно выполнять с двоичными деревьями, включают вставку, удаление и обход.

Запрос на удаление Посмотреть полный ответ на baeldung.com

Как деревья используются в машинном обучении?

Введение Деревья решений — это тип контролируемого машинного обучения (то есть вы объясняете, что такое входные данные и каковы соответствующие выходные данные в обучающих данных), где данные постоянно разделяются в соответствии с определенным параметром. Дерево можно объяснить двумя сущностями, а именно узлами решений и листьями.

Запрос на удаление Посмотреть полный ответ на xoriant.com

Каковы недостатки древовидной структуры данных?

Недостаток:
  • Небольшое изменение данных может вызвать большие изменения в структуре дерева решений, что приведет к нестабильности.
  • Для дерева решений иногда расчет может быть гораздо более сложным по сравнению с другими алгоритмами.
  • Дерево решений часто требует больше времени на обучение модели.

Запрос на удаление Посмотреть полный ответ на dhirajkumarblog.medium.com

Какой метод программирования деревьев наиболее распространен?

Самый распространенный тип дерева — двоичное дерево. Этот тип дерева назван так потому, что у каждого родительского узла может быть только два дочерних узла.

Запрос на удаление Посмотреть полный ответ на сайте Study.com

Каковы 4 преимущества деревьев?

Деревья выделяют кислород, которым нам нужно дышать. Деревья уменьшают объем ливневых стоков, что снижает эрозию и загрязнение наших водных путей и может уменьшить последствия наводнений. Многие виды дикой природы зависят от деревьев как среды обитания. Деревья обеспечивают пищу, защиту и дом для многих птиц и млекопитающих.

Запрос на удаление Посмотреть полный ответ на bgky.org

Как преобразовать дерево в массив в C?

Как преобразовать двоичное дерево поиска в массив в программировании на C
  1. Первый шаг: создание объекта массива. Во-первых, вы должны создать объект с именем array arr[], который будет храниться в дереве поиска.
  2. Второй шаг: отсортируйте объект массива. Теперь пришло время отсортировать объект массива.
  3. Третий шаг: скопируйте массив в узлы дерева.

Запрос на удаление Посмотреть полный ответ на codewithc.com

Как удалить дерево в C?

Чтобы удалить дерево, нам нужно обойти каждый узел дерева, а затем удалить каждый из них. это один за другим удаляет каждый узел дерева и делает его пустым.

Запрос на удаление Полный ответ можно посмотреть на сайте Tutorialspoint.com.

Что такое программа двоичного дерева на языке C?

Программа двоичного дерева на языке C представляет собой нелинейную структуру данных, используемую для поиска и организации данных. Бинарное дерево состоит из узлов, каждый из которых является компонентом данных и имеет левый и правый дочерние узлы.

Запрос на удаление Посмотреть полный ответ на educba.com

Что такое древовидный алгоритм?

Древовидная структура данных — это алгоритм размещения и поиска файлов (называемых записями или ключами) в базе данных. Алгоритм находит данные, неоднократно делая выбор в точках принятия решений, называемых узлами. Узел может иметь от двух ветвей (также называемых дочерними) или до нескольких десятков.

Запрос на удаление Посмотреть полный ответ на techtarget.com

Насколько публикация полезна?

Нажмите на звезду, чтобы оценить!

Средняя оценка 0 / 5. Количество оценок: 0

Оценок пока нет. Поставьте оценку первым.

Оставьте комментарий

Прокрутить вверх